SBFM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2023 in Review
4 of the 6,302 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Sunshine Biopharma (SBFM) for Q3 2023, worth a combined $415K — down 67% from $1.25M a quarter earlier.
Fund positioning in SBFM was balanced in Q3 2023: 1 fund opened new positions, 1 closed out, 0 added to existing stakes and 1 trimmed.
The largest buyer was HRT Financial, opening a new position worth an estimated $8.95K. The largest seller was Armistice Capital, cutting an estimated $546K.
